-usage="Usage: $prog [OPTION]... PACKAGE MANUAL-TITLE
-
-Generate output in various formats from PACKAGE.texinfo (or .texi or
-.txi) source. See the GNU Maintainers document for a more extensive
-discussion:
- http://www.gnu.org/prep/maintain_toc.html
-
-Options:
- --email ADR use ADR as contact in generated web pages; always give this.
-
- -s SRCFILE read Texinfo from SRCFILE, instead of PACKAGE.{texinfo|texi|txi}
- -o OUTDIR write files into OUTDIR, instead of manual/.
- -I DIR append DIR to the Texinfo search path.
- --common ARG pass ARG in all invocations.
- --html ARG pass ARG to makeinfo or texi2html for HTML targets.
- --info ARG pass ARG to makeinfo for Info, instead of --no-split.
- --no-ascii skip generating the plain text output.
- --no-copy-images
- don't try to copy images referenced by img HTML tags,
- --source ARG include ARG in tar archive of sources.
- --split HOW make split HTML by node, section, chapter; default node.
-
- --texi2html use texi2html to make HTML target, with all split versions.
- --docbook convert through DocBook too (xml, txt, html, pdf).
-
- --help display this help and exit successfully.
- --version display version information and exit successfully.
-
-Simple example: $prog --email bug-gnu-emacs@gnu.org emacs \"GNU Emacs Manual\"
-
-Typical sequence:
- cd PACKAGESOURCE/doc
- wget \"$scripturl\"
- wget \"$templateurl\"
- $prog --email BUGLIST MANUAL \"GNU MANUAL - One-line description\"
-
-Output will be in a new subdirectory \"manual\" (by default;
-use -o OUTDIR to override). Move all the new files into your web CVS
-tree, as explained in the Web Pages node of maintain.texi.
-
-Please use the --email ADDRESS option so your own bug-reporting
-address will be used in the generated HTML pages.
-
-MANUAL-TITLE is included as part of the HTML <title> of the overall
-manual/index.html file. It should include the name of the package being
-documented. manual/index.html is created by substitution from the file
-$GENDOCS_TEMPLATE_DIR/gendocs_template. (Feel free to modify the
-generic template for your own purposes.)
-
-If you have several manuals, you'll need to run this script several
-times with different MANUAL values, specifying a different output
-directory with -o each time. Then write (by hand) an overall index.html
-with links to them all.
-
-If a manual's Texinfo sources are spread across several directories,
-first copy or symlink all Texinfo sources into a single directory.
-(Part of the script's work is to make a tar.gz of the sources.)
-
-As implied above, by default monolithic Info files are generated.
-If you want split Info, or other Info options, use --info to override.
-
-You can set the environment variables MAKEINFO, TEXI2DVI, TEXI2HTML,
-and PERL to control the programs that get executed, and
-GENDOCS_TEMPLATE_DIR to control where the gendocs_template file is
-looked for. With --docbook, the environment variables DOCBOOK2HTML,
-DOCBOOK2PDF, and DOCBOOK2TXT are also consulted.
-
-By default, makeinfo and texi2dvi are run in the default (English)
-locale, since that's the language of most Texinfo manuals. If you
-happen to have a non-English manual and non-English web site, see the
-SETLANG setting in the source.
-
-Email bug reports or enhancement requests to bug-texinfo@gnu.org.
-"
